if test -z "$srcdir"; then
srcdir=.
test "${VERBOSE+set}" != "set" && VERBOSE=yes
fi
# See how redirections should work.
if test -z "$VERBOSE"; then
exec > /dev/null 2>&1
fi
path=`dirname $0`
if ! test -f "./fribidi"; then
echo "run.tests: you must make fribidi first"
exit 1
fi
TEST () {
testcase="$1"
test="${testcase##*/}"
test="${test%.input}"
charset="${testcase#*_}"
charset="${charset%%_*}"
echo -n "=== $test === "
if ! ./fribidi --charset "$charset" </dev/null >/dev/null 2>&1; then
echo " [Character set not supported]"
return 0
fi
./fribidi --test --charset "$charset" "$testcase" > "$test.output"
reference="${testcase%.input}.reference";
test -f "$reference" || reference="tests/${reference##*/}"
if diff "$test.output" "$reference"; then
rm "$test.output"
echo " [Passed]"
return 0
else
echo " [Failed]"
return 1
fi
}
retval=0
for testcase in "$path/tests/"test_*.input; do
TEST "$testcase" || retval=1
done
exit $retval
